Depends on the size of the eel... on average, 4/0 gami is big enough to land the biggest bass in the sea.... for true snakes.. over 18" I'll go as big as 6/0... the bigger the hook, the harder it is to set... always use the smallest hook you can get away with....

I been useing the Gami 18416 6/0, a live heavy bait hook. One of the things I look for in an eel hook is the barb, a good barb will save you alot of eels in the course of a season...I noticed a significant difference since switching over from octopus style hooks.
